AK Steel hikes carbon steel surcharge

Middletown based AK Steel has recently announced that it increases surcharge on carbon steel products to $120 per ton to be in effect for the shipments as of May 1, 2004, following the increase on surcharge of electrical steel sheet and strip products. April surcharge on carbon steel products was $97 per ton. The new surcharge is determined based on change in costs of raw materials, such as energy and scrap.
